Islamabad: The federal government mulled options to end Saturday as a holiday, the sources familiar with the development said on Tuesday.
The Cabinet Division asked all the ministries to come up with the suggestions regarding cancellation of the Saturday as holiday.
The sources said that once this feedback is gathered, the matter would be submitted to the federal cabinet for approval.
The reports suggested that the results of observing Saturday as a holiday were unsatisfactory.
The proposal to discontinue the Saturday holiday would be reviewed in a cabinet meeting after Eid-ul-Adha.
